数据库敲代码有哪些特点
-
数据库编程具有以下几个特点:
-
数据模型设计:在数据库编程中,首先需要进行数据模型的设计。这涉及到数据库表的创建、字段的定义以及表之间的关系。良好的数据模型设计能够提高系统的性能和可维护性。
-
SQL语言:数据库编程通常需要使用SQL语言与数据库进行交互,包括数据的增删改查操作,以及对数据的约束和索引的管理。熟练掌握SQL语言对于数据库编程至关重要。
-
数据一致性和完整性:在数据库编程中,需要确保数据的一致性和完整性。这包括对数据进行有效性校验、事务管理和异常处理等方面的工作。
-
性能优化:数据库编程涉及到大量数据的读写操作,因此需要对数据库的性能进行优化。这包括对SQL查询语句的优化、索引的设计和数据库连接池的管理等。
-
安全性:数据库编程要求对数据进行安全保护,包括对用户身份的认证、数据的加密和权限的管理等方面。
综上所述,数据库编程需要对数据模型设计、SQL语言、数据一致性和完整性、性能优化以及安全性等方面有深入的了解和实践经验。
1年前 -
-
数据库编程是指在软件开发过程中使用编程语言与数据库进行交互,从而实现对数据的管理和操作。数据库编程具有以下特点:
-
数据库连接管理:在数据库编程中,需要建立到数据库的连接并管理这些连接。合理地管理数据库连接可以提高程序的性能和稳定性。
-
SQL语句的使用:数据库编程通常需要使用结构化查询语言(SQL)来与数据库进行交互,包括查询数据、插入、更新和删除等操作。熟练掌握SQL语句对于数据库编程至关重要。
-
数据库事务处理:在数据库编程中,经常需要处理事务,保证数据的完整性和一致性。事务可以确保数据库操作要么全部执行成功,要么全部失败,避免数据不一致的情况发生。
-
数据库设计能力:数据库编程需要对数据库进行设计,包括表的设计、字段的定义、索引的建立等。合理的数据库设计可以提高系统的性能和可维护性。
-
数据库性能优化:在数据库编程过程中,需要考虑如何优化数据库的性能,包括合理使用索引、减少不必要的查询、优化SQL语句等。性能优化可以提高系统的响应速度和稳定性。
-
异常处理机制:在数据库编程中,需要考虑各种异常情况的处理,包括数据库连接异常、SQL语句执行异常等。良好的异常处理机制可以提高系统的健壮性和可靠性。
-
数据安全性保障:在数据库编程中,需要考虑如何保障数据的安全性,包括权限管理、数据加密、预防SQL注入攻击等。数据安全是系统设计中至关重要的一环。
总的来说,数据库编程需要结合数据库知识、SQL语句和编程技能,保证系统对数据的稳健管理和高效操作。通过不断的学习和实践,可以提升数据库编程的水平,设计出更加稳定和高效的数据库程序。
1年前 -
-
数据库敲代码是指通过编程的方式与数据库交互,从而实现对数据库的管理、操作和查询。数据库敲代码有如下特点:
-
灵活性:通过编程的方式操作数据库,相对于图形化界面,能够更加灵活地实现复杂的业务逻辑。可以根据具体需求灵活地编写代码,实现个性化的数据库操作。
-
自动化:通过编程,可以实现自动化的数据库操作,比如定时任务、批量处理等。这样,大大减少了手动操作的时间和可能出现的错误。
-
可扩展性:通过编程实现的数据库操作,可以很好地适应系统的变化和需求的增加,易于扩展和维护。
-
性能优化:通过编程可以更加针对性地实现数据库操作,优化查询语句、事务处理等,从而提高数据库操作的性能。
-
安全性:编程方式可以更好地控制对数据库的访问权限,实现更加精细的权限控制和安全策略。
-
整合性:通过编程,可以将数据库操作与业务逻辑、系统流程等融合在一起,实现更加完整的系统。
基于以上特点,数据库敲代码成为了大多数开发者处理数据库的首选方式。通过编程,可以更好地实现对数据库的管理、操作和查询,并与业务逻辑相结合,更好地满足系统的需求。
1年前 -


